Andreas Bordan (born May 14, 1964 ) is a former German soccer player .
Career
Andreas Bordan played in the youth team of FC Schalke 04 . As a Schalke youth talent, he took part in Frank Elstner's Monday painter with the then Schalke professionals Erwin Kremers and Helmut Kremers , Rolf Rüssmann and Jürgen Sobieray . As a B youth player, he reached the final of the German football championship with the Knappen in the 1979/80 season . The team failed in the final in the Gelsenkirchen Glückauf-Kampfbahn against Eintracht Frankfurt . The next year Bordan played in the A-Jugend and again reached the final of the German Junior Championship . The final against VfB Stuttgart was also lost. In his second year in the A-Jugend he moved to VfL Bochum , in 1982 Bordan was part of the Bochum squad in the Bundesliga . After two years he went to SV Darmstadt 98 . National team
In August 1980 he played the Nordland tournament in Germany with the German U-17 team . Besides Germany, participants were: Denmark, Finland, Iceland, Norway and Sweden. After victories against Denmark (2-0) in Fulda and Iceland (5-0) in Stadtallendorf, they lost the final in Marburg against Norway with 0-1.
